Getting out of the city for a day was exactly what I needed. The waterfalls offered a refreshing afternoon and stunning views. Pack a bathing suit, because you can’t come to Erawan falls and not swim! The JEATH museum was nice, but I was just here for the waterfalls.

Jack was really friendly and had great information to share with us during our time with him. We learned a lot at the museum and had fun seeing the train cross the bridge while getting some tasty snacks and souvenirs at the market on our way to the falls. The hike was intense at times with steep steps along the way, but at every turn there was a magical picturesque moment. Every waterfall was beautiful ❤️ Would recommend!
